Engineering Design Technology – From Pencil Sketches to Digital Twins

It is rather interesting to delve into the history of almost anything! And this is especially true when we investigate the past of modern technology. If there is one thing that is galloping away at almost unbelievable speeds, it is engineering design. From the days of physical blueprints and sketches to today’s world filled with artificial intelligence and digital twins, the world of design has come a long way indeed.

What has changed?

If we were to ask you to describe the most fundamental changes that engineering design technology has gone through – what would you say?

Among the many fascinating changes, one of the most important paradigm shifts is the move from manual to digital. Engineers of yore did their best work by drawing sketches - actual sketches – pen, paper, et al. Today, a computer, thanks to Computer-aided design (CAD), can help an engineer design virtually anything including a digital twin.

Engineer working with a 3D software on a screen

This change is not limited to the visual outputs of design alone. It has also resulted in:

  • Higher productivity
  • Lower errors
  • Greater sophistication
  • Smarter collaboration
  • More effective problem-solving
  • Maximum precision

What else?

Engineering design technology has also grown in its fundamental nature. It is not restricted to simply building something. Technology enables engineers to work in tandem with experts from other fields to create truly human-centric solutions. For instance, a precision castings manufacturer like us can harness the power of advanced design tools to work with customers in diverse industries to create applications that are tailor-made for them.

Designs can undergo multiple iterations to incorporate

  • Specific geometries
  • Customised applications
  • Material needs
  • Climatic situations and so on.

It is safe and pertinent to state that engineering design technology is not just transforming the way we make castings but is refining the way we think. Design technology is helping us innovate, use more intelligent tools, and stay even more connected with our customers.
